Temple Visits

Three Temples Loop With Spice Trail (One Day Tour) - Temple Visits

Visitors to the Three Temples Loop with Spice Trail tour in Kandy, Sri Lanka, will embark on a spiritual journey exploring ancient temples that hold deep cultural significance.

The tour includes visits to three prominent temples: the Temple of the Sacred Tooth Relic, where a sacred tooth of the Buddha is enshrined, Gadaladeniya Temple known for its unique architecture blending South Indian and Sinhalese styles, and Lankatilaka Temple with its massive standing Buddha statue and stunning views of the surrounding countryside.

Each temple offers a glimpse into Sri Lanka’s rich religious heritage and architectural prowess. From intricate carvings to serene surroundings, these temples provide a tranquil escape for visitors seeking spiritual enlightenment and culture.

Is There a Dress Code That Visitors Need to Adhere to at the Temples?

Visitors to the temples in Kandy may need to adhere to a dress code. Modest attire is typically expected, covering shoulders and knees. It’s advisable to carry a shawl or scarf for added coverage.
